God's Righteous People ... By Faith
GALATIANS 3:6-9
Understand that in the same way that Abraham believed God and it was
credited to him as righteousness, those who believe are the children of
Abraham. But when it saw ahead of time that God would make the
Gentiles righteous on the basis of faith, scripture preached the gospel
in advance to Abraham: All the Gentiles will be blessed in you.
Therefore, those who believe are blessed together with Abraham who
believed.
GALATIANS 3:23-29
Before faith came, we were guarded under the Law, locked up until
faith that was coming would be revealed, so that the Law became our
custodian until Christ so that we might be made righteous by faith. But
now that faith has come, we are no longer under a custodian.
You are all God’s children through faith in Christ Jesus. All of you who
were baptized into Christ have clothed yourselves with Christ. There is
neither Jew nor Greek; there is neither slave nor free; nor is there
male and female, for you are all one in Christ Jesus. Now if you belong
to Christ, then indeed you are Abraham’s descendants, heirs according
2. to the promise.
Faith brings Righteousness.
All who believe in Christ become children of God.
Believers are all ONE in Christ Jesus.
Believers in Christ are Abraham's Seed (Heirs of the Promise)
Questions for Personal or Group Reflection
1. What is the significance of Paul's question to the Galatians in verse 2?
2. What does the story of Abraham teach us about faith and
righteousness?
3. Who are the true children of Abraham? Who can be one?
4. What is the promise that God game Abraham in Genesis 12:2-3?
5. Who is the seed through whom the promise to Abraham is fulfilled?
6. Since the Law did not replace the promise, what was its purpose?
7. What kinds of legalism do Christians sometimes fall into?
8. How does your faith free you from that bondage?

7. WCUMC Trustees have begun a Capital Improvement project to reduce
our energy footprint and expenses by replacing all outdoor and indoor
overhead lights (except Sanctuary) with LED lights, and replacing all T12 florescent bulbs with T-8 florescent bulbs. T-8 bulbs will last 10
years, will not flicker and buzz, and will reduce energy cost by 25% 50%.
Additionally, PSE has announced a Rebate Program to encourage
retrofit. WCUMC estimated rebate will be $9,000, and retrofit should
generate savings of approximately $4,500 per year.
A Designated Fund to raise the $26,500 needed for the full project has
been established.
